Output 268be4360a326c5b5d0ee742f32b5f40a184836921563d25fa7d750c4aade5e1:4

value
344706
script pubkey
OP_0 OP_PUSHBYTES_32 48aa88f84449e126bf950a216296677cdab30df3c976284ef03e4cc7b26ae03a
address
bc1qfz4g37zyf8sjd0u4pgsk99n80ndtxr0ne9mzsnhs8exv0vn2uqaqzuwajm
transaction
268be4360a326c5b5d0ee742f32b5f40a184836921563d25fa7d750c4aade5e1
confirmations
78425
spent
true